Alex Craves the Rush. A broken man living on the fringes, he’s addicted to fear—the kind that claws at your chest and makes your pulse race. When he discovers The Murder Exchange, a website on the dark web where death is for sale and murder is entertainment, he’s hooked. Autumn Is Vengeance in Red Lipstick. She’s chaos wrapped in beauty, with a vendetta that knows no limits. When she collides with Alex, they become partners in crime, hunting the untouchable men who believe they’re above consequence. Together, they turn murder into a spectacle—and their dark desires into addiction. But revenge is never simple, and as their kills pile up, so do the consequences. The lines blur. Justice becomes an obsession. And on The Murder Exchange, every click feeds a hungry audience eager for blood.
